How to find Laguna Pre-code

The security pre-code is the standard way to unlock Tuner List units. If the software shortcut fails, you must remove the radio to find the serial.

  • Try Shortcut: Hold buttons 1 and 6. A code like V123 should appear. If it doesn't, the radio must be pulled out using extraction keys.
  • Full Serial Identification: Check the sticker for a long string like 8200300858TJ902. The pre-code is the last 4 characters: J902.
  • Barcode Example: You might see a barcode with 281150038RTW102. In this specific case, your required pre-code for the generator is W102.
  • Other Label Formats: Look for a small box labeled SECURITY containing a letter and 3 digits (e.g. F102) located at the end of the 15-digit serial number.

How to Enter Renault Laguna Radio Code

After generating your 4-digit PIN, you must input it correctly into the system. The entry procedure differs depending on whether you have a Laguna II Tuner List or a Laguna III Carminat/Bose system.

Option 1: Using Radio Buttons (1-6)

Standard for 1-DIN units found in Laguna 2 (2001-2007) and basic Laguna 3 models.

1

Press Button 1 repeatedly until the first digit of your code is displayed.

2

Press Button 2 repeatedly for the second digit of your PIN.

3

Press Button 3 repeatedly for the third digit.

4

Press Button 4 repeatedly for the final digit.

To validate, press and hold Button 6 for 5-10 seconds until you hear a confirmation beep.

Option 2: Steering Wheel Stalk (Satellite)

The most common method for Laguna III and high-spec Cabasse systems.

1

Use the thumbwheel (scroll wheel) on the back of the stalk to cycle through numbers 0-9.

2

Press the bottom button (or 'source' button) to confirm the digit and move to the next slot.

3

Repeat the process for all four digits of your authentication key.

To confirm the complete code, press and hold the bottom button until the radio activates.

Is your screen showing "CODE" or "WAIT"?

If you entered the wrong PIN, Renault systems trigger a security lockout. The word "WAIT" means you must leave the radio switched ON. The lockout generally lasts 30 minutes. Do not disconnect the battery during this time, or the timer will reset to the beginning.

Troubleshooting Renault Laguna Radio Issues

Sometimes, even with the correct 4-digit PIN, your Laguna audio system might experience technical glitches. Here are the most common hardware and software issues for Laguna II and III models.

Radio Display shows "ERROR" or "WAIT"

This happens after entering the wrong code multiple times. The system locks you out to prevent theft.

The Fix: Leave the ignition and the radio ON. Do not turn it off. After 20 to 60 minutes, the screen will revert to "0000" or "CODE", allowing you to try again.

Buttons 1-6 or Stalk Not Responding

Common on Laguna II Phase 1 units where the rubber membrane behind the buttons wears out.

The Fix: Try using the steering wheel stalk (satellite) instead. If neither works, check the fuse box in the dashboard (left side).

Correct Code is Not Accepted

If the generated PIN is rejected, your Laguna might have a replacement radio from another vehicle.

The Fix: The VIN method won't work. You must pull the radio out and use the Security Pre-code from the actual sticker on the unit.

Laguna 3 Navigation Black Screen

On Carminat TomTom systems, the radio might stay silent with a black screen after a battery change.

The Fix: Ensure the SD card is properly inserted. If the screen is off, try entering the code "blindly" using the steering wheel stalk.

Quick Laguna Radio Checklist:

Fuse Check: 15A fuse usually labeled "Radio/Nav".

Serial Check: Letters 'I' and '1' or 'O' and '0' are often confused.

Battery: Low voltage can cause the radio to lose memory.

Antenna: If no signal, check the Fakra connector behind the unit.
